引言
随着数字货币和区块链技术的快速发展,去中心化应用(DApp)逐渐成为一个热议的话题。尤其是在与各类Token交互方面,如何高效可靠地调用TokenIM成为了开发者们的重要考量。本文将为您深入解析什么是TokenIM,它在DApp中的应用,以及如何高效调用TokenIM,实现您的区块链梦想。
TokenIM是什么?

TokenIM是一种便捷的Token管理工具,性能卓越且功能丰富,专为去中心化应用(DApp)而设计。它不仅允许用户方便地管理和交易Tokens,还能与其他区块链服务快速无缝地集成。TokenIM的核心优势在于其高安全性以及用户友好的界面,使得无论是新手还是经验丰富的开发者都能在其中找到适合自己的操作方式。
DApp的基本概念
在超越传统应用的过程中,DApp应运而生。DApp的定义非常广泛,通常被称为“去中心化应用程序”,具有以下几个特点:运行在区块链网络中、依赖智能合约、安全性高、具备开放性和自主性。近年来,各种DApp层出不穷,包括去中心化交易所、借贷平台、游戏等,几乎涵盖了生活的方方面面。
TokenIM在DApp中的重要性

对于开发者来说,TokenIM是连接DApp与区块链世界的桥梁。通过TokenIM,开发者能够便捷地实现Token的转账、管理和查询等多种操作。同时,TokenIM的安全性为用户的资产保驾护航,减少了因潜在漏洞而导致的资金损失。此外,TokenIM还支持多种主流区块链网络,极大地拓展了DApp的应用场景。这样的特点,使得TokenIM成为DApp开发过程中不可或缺的工具。
如何调用TokenIM?
调用TokenIM的过程其实并不复杂,但在实际操作中需要开发者具备一定的编程基础和对区块链的了解。接下来,我们将分步骤详细阐述如何在客户端DApp中调用TokenIM。
第一步:环境配置
调用TokenIM之前,您需要准备好合适的开发环境。这包括选择适合的编程语言(如JavaScript、Python等)、安装必要的开发工具包,并配置区块链节点的环境。接下来,确保您能够访问TokenIM的API,这通常需要创建一个开发者账号并获取API密钥。
第二步:连接TokenIM
在您的DApp代码中,您需要通过API密钥实现与TokenIM的连接。下面是一个伪代码示例,帮助您快速理解如何连接TokenIM:
const tokenIM = require('tokenim-sdk'); // 引入TokenIM SDK const apiKey = '您的API密钥'; // 设置API密钥 const client = new tokenIM.Client(apiKey); // 创建TokenIM客户端
通过以上代码,您便成功初始化了TokenIM客户端,后续操作即可通过这个client对象进行。
第三步:调用Token操作
一旦连接成功,您可以开始执行各种Token操作。例如,您可以查询某个Token的余额,执行转账,或者获取Token交易历史。以下是一个查询余额的简单示例:
async function checkBalance(address) { const balance = await client.getBalance(address); // 获取账户余额 console.log('账户余额:', balance); }
而转账操作同样简单,以下是一段可能的转账代码:
async function transferTokens(fromAddress, toAddress, amount) { const tx = await client.transfer(fromAddress, toAddress, amount); // 执行转账 console.log('转账成功,交易ID:', tx.id); }
丰富的TokenIM功能
TokenIM不仅仅是一个简单的Token管理工具,它还支持非常多样的功能例如多链支持、实时数据分析、合约调用等。利用这些功能,开发者能够构建出更为丰富多彩的DApp。
1. 多链支持
TokenIM支持众多主流的区块链网络,这意味着您可以轻松地在不同链之间进行Token管理和交易。例如,您可以在Ethereum上发行自己的Token,同时也能在Binance Smart Chain上进行同样的操作。这种灵活性无疑为DApp的开发提供了极大的便利。
2. 实时数据分析
利用TokenIM的实时数据分析功能,开发者能够深刻理解用户的行为与需求,从而更好地产品与服务。通过收集数据,分析用户的操作习惯,您可以制定更为精准的市场策略,不断提高DApp的用户粘性和活跃度。
3. 合约调用
TokenIM的智能合约调用功能让您能轻松与DApp中的合约进行交互。这一功能特别适合需要进行复杂金融操作的应用场景。例如,您可以利用智能合约自动执行贷款、借款等操作,确保一切在安全和透明的环境下进行。
TokenIM的安全性
在区块链生态中,安全性始终是开发者和用户最为关心的问题。TokenIM在安全性方面做了大量的投入与研发,采用了多重安全机制,包括对用户数据的加密保护、针对敏感操作的双重验证等。此外,TokenIM还会定期进行安全审计,以确保系统不受到外部攻击和内存漏洞的侵害。
案例分析:成功的DApp项目
为了更具体地说明TokenIM的应用,我们可以看几个成功利用TokenIM的DApp项目。这些项目利用TokenIM实现了高效的Token管理和流畅的用户体验,获得了用户的广泛认可。
1. 去中心化金融(DeFi)平台
许多去中心化金融平台通过TokenIM实现了流动性管理、高效的用户互动以及资产的自动化管理。用户可以在平台上自由参与借贷与交易,大大提升了资金的流动性。
2. 游戏DApp
在区块链游戏中,TokenIM不仅用来管理游戏内的Token,还能确保玩家的资产安全。例如,玩家在游戏中获得的虚拟资产可以通过TokenIM进行安全转账、拍卖等操作,而这一切都是在去中心化的环境下实现的。
未来展望
伴随着区块链和数字货币的持续爆发,TokenIM作为一种高效便捷的Token管理工具,将继续在DApp的开发中扮演越来越重要的角色。在未来,我们或许将看到TokenIM集成更多功能,如支持NFT的管理、采用新的共识机制提升效率、与AI技术的结合等。这些都将进一步推动区块链技术的普及与应用,为数字经济的发展注入新的动力。
结语
总之,TokenIM为开发者提供了一个强大而灵活的平台,使他们能够更加高效地构建和管理DApp。在未来的日子里,随着技术的不断进步,TokenIM有望成为更多企业和开发者的首选工具。希望本文能对您理解TokenIM的价值与应用有所帮助,激发您对区块链世界的探索与实践!